Metallurgical Engineering is the 308th most popular major in the country with 207 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, metallurgical engineering gra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$68,650 and had an average of $20,130 in loans still to pay off.

Across Nevada, there were 4 metallurgical engineering gra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end University of Nevada - Reno. The school came in at #1 for the Best Value Metallurgical Engineering Schools in Nevada For Those Making $0-$30k. UNR is a large school located in Reno, Nevada that handed out 4 ’s metallurgical engineering degrees in 2019-2020.

UNR also took the #1 spot in our “Best Metallurgical Engineering Schools in Nevada” ranking. The estimated yearly cost for UNR is $11,587 for Nevada Metallurgical Engineering students whose families make $0-$30k.
